I accidentally turned on the Word Tracking Changes feature when creating a
document using form drop downs. After receving the replies back, the
tracking shows "Field Code Changed" but no value for the drop downs (which
have also disappeared). I tried doing the ALT-F9 Stuff to view the codes and
stuff and it tells me "FORMDROPDOWN" with some boxes after it. Is there any
way to get the value the drop down was changed to?

No, I don't believe there is, at least, not directly. You could use a macro that
fires on exiting the dropdown to write the value into a directly adjacent form
field. The macro would then select a "space" entry from the dropdown list so
that it "disappears". More on this approach in the forms section on my website.

Anothe approach would be to not use a dropdown, just a textbox, and trigger a
macro to show a UserForm with the list on entering the text field.
